Day 2
Breakfast in the morning at the hotel.
In the afternoon visit Five Rathas is a complex of monuments in the district of Kancheepuram in Tamilnadu Five Rathas is an example of Indian monolithic architecture carved into the rock. This complex was carved during the reign of King Narasimhavarman-I (630-668 AD). Later we will The Shore Temple (built in 700-728 AD) is so called because it faces the coast of the Bay of Bengal. This temple is a structural temple, built with blocks of granite, dating from the eighth century. At the time of construction, this entire site was a busy port during the reign of Narasimhavarman II of the Pallava dynasty. As a member of the Monuments Group in Mahabalipuram, it has been classified as a Unesco World Heritage Site since 1984. Overnight at the hotel.
Day 3
Breakfast at the hotel.
Departure to Pondicherry, a French colonial settlement in India until 1954, it is now a Union territory in the state of Tamil Nadu. His French legacy is preserved in the French Quarter, with elegant boutiques and tree-lined streets.
A boardwalk runs along the Bay of Bengal. Upon arrival check-in at the hotel.
Afternoon Orientation Tour of Pondicherry, a portion of France still exists in India in Pondicherry.
This city had been passed to multiple colonial powers of Dutch, Portuguese and English but predominantly French. When Pondicherry was handed over to India, residents were given the option to keep their French passport. Overnight at the hotel.

Day 11
Breakfast at the hotel.
Mattancherry Palace is a town in the city of Kochi, India. It is said that the name Mattancherry comes from "Ancherry Mattom", a '' Namboodiri illam '' that foreign traders then pronounced as Matt-Ancherry, gradually became Mattancherry. Then we will visit the Jewish synagogue,
The Jews or Yehudan Mappila, also known as Cochin Jews or Yehudan Mappila, formed a prosperous commercial community of Kerala. In 1568, the Jews built the Synagogue adjacent to Mattancherry, on the land that gave them the Kochi Raja. Late afternoon visit Kathakali Dance form is one of the most important forms of traditional Indian classical dance. Overnight at Hotel
